Inpatient hospitalization programs in Butler, New Jersey are a kind of drug rehabilitation facility which delivers treatment in a hospital or similar setting where the treatment process can be supervised by medical staff as well as addiction professionals. As is generally the case with alcohol and benzodiazepine withdrawal, it is often vital for an individual to be in an inpatient hospitalization program during detoxification because the withdrawal symptoms can be life threatening. Inpatient hospitalization programs are also an option for those in Butler who wish to undergo medication assisted withdrawal, which is typically used in the case of illicit opiate or prescription pain reliever addiction. Most people in Butler who choose this treatment method however and don't continue on with additional drug rehab typically have very high rates of relapse. In either case, addicted individuals should follow up detox with an intensive rehabilitation program either in inpatient hospitalization or in some other drug rehab facility.
